Output 28a4102862d562c0546e6ec148626a9b3814d67a263b5925112da4c2b8b6c6cc:3

value
187352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d81fb46a090c3d4a96567de6d680f9c5123365 OP_EQUAL
address
33xP3hJwxo3YPSA4Dkv5C8E6d3DDNGGPhB
transaction
28a4102862d562c0546e6ec148626a9b3814d67a263b5925112da4c2b8b6c6cc
confirmations
290431
spent
true